We had two requests for repairs with HWA - of an AC and of a microwave.in both cases HWA sent subcontractors who are not adequately equipped to handle the customer's volume or variety of equipment. Subcontractors work the governmental hours of 8 to 5 as if this is still the 50s and there are stay at home mom to accommodate their schedule. No flexibility in scheduling.

In both cases spare parts had to be ordered and wait for 2-3 weeks to "locate" the part. During our microwave repair the subcontractor argued in front of us with the HWA rep how much that particular part will cost. The price range of the argument was between $17.50 and $185!?!

Also, once the parts were located we had to wait another few weeks for the subcontractors to have available time to come and finish the repair. Since in both case two different subcontractors had the same issues handling the customer's volume, it is indicative that HWA have bigger problems and have not made any effort to higher quality subcontractors. Not to mention that throughout the time of the claims the HWA representative are useless.

We have the HWA warranty from the previous owner of the house. It is to expire in February and we already got an offer from HWA to renew the warranty with an increased premium. Almost double! For $500 that they want for a year of premium and considering the value of my time wasted I am much better of putting those money in a savings account for emergency repairs.
